&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;New page&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;div&gt;Toaq is a tonal language. It has &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;tones&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;! That is: saying a word with a rising or falling vocal intonation, for example, makes for a difference in meaning.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
== Function of tones ==&lt;br /&gt;
Toaq has &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;grammatical tone&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;: when you change the tone of a word, its grammatical function changes (for example {{t|dẻ}} “is beautiful” → {{t|dẽ}} “beautifully”).&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
(This is in contrast to &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;lexical tone&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;, like in Chinese: there, when you change the tone of a syllable, it becomes a different word (lexeme) entirely. For example 西 xı̄ “west” → 媳 xí “daughter-in-law”.)&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
== Verb tones ==&lt;br /&gt;
Every verb can be &amp;quot;conjugated&amp;quot; into one of six tones, each of which expresses some grammatical function:&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
# (see [[#History|History section]] for why there is no tone #1)&lt;br /&gt;
# The &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;rising tone&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; {{tone|2}} marks a noun or [[bound variable]]. ({{t|súq}} “you”, {{t|sa pỏq… póq}} “some person… that person”)&lt;br /&gt;
# The &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;rising-creaky tone&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; {{tone|3}} marks the start of a [[relative clause]]. ({{t|gï}} “which is good”)&lt;br /&gt;
# The &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;falling tone&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; {{tone|4}} marks a verb phrase, or the tail of a [[serial]]. ({{t|fả}} “goes”, {{t|bũ dẻ}} “not-beautifully”)&lt;br /&gt;
# The &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;rising-falling tone&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; {{tone|5}} marks the start of a [[content clause]]. ({{t|gî}} “that it&amp;#039;s good”)&lt;br /&gt;
# The &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;mid-falling tone&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; {{tone|6}} marks a [[preposition]]. ({{t|bìe ní}} “after that”)&lt;br /&gt;
# The &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;falling creaky tone&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; {{tone|7}} marks an [[adverb]]. ({{t|dẽ}} “beautifully”)&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Sometimes people will say “the fifth tone” or “t5” instead of “the rising-falling tone”.&lt;br /&gt;

=== Possible new tone scheme ===&lt;br /&gt;
&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Main Article: [[Main verb tone]]&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
On 21 August 2022, Hoemaı mentioned trying to settle on a new tone scheme.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
# {{tone|1}} — adjunct (adverbs and prepositions)&lt;br /&gt;
# {{tone|2}} — nouns or bound variable&lt;br /&gt;
# {{tone|3}} — allotone of {{tone|7}}; alternatively if adverbs and prepositions stay separate, it would take one of those functions&lt;br /&gt;
# {{tone|4}} — tail of a serial&lt;br /&gt;
# {{tone|5}} — relative clauses&lt;br /&gt;
# {{tone|6}} — main verb&lt;br /&gt;
# {{tone|7}} — content clauses&lt;br /&gt;
# {{tone|8}} — particles&lt;br /&gt;
# {{tone|3old}} — allotone of {{tone|6}}&lt;br /&gt;

== Neutral tone ==&lt;br /&gt;
Particles, on the other hand, are in the &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;neutral tone&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; {{tone|8}} (aka the 8th tone), which is not really a tone. The only rule is that you don&amp;#039;t continue the contour of the previous tone. So, when saying a particle after the falling tone {{tone|4}}, you should go up in pitch to break the falling contour. This way, the listener can tell the difference between {{t|lẻ moq}} and {{t|lẻmoq}}.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
== Lexical tone ==&lt;br /&gt;
Toaq actually does have a little bit of lexical tone. For example, {{t|moq}} (question marker) and {{t|môq}} (rhetorical question marker) are different lexemes.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
More subtly, {{t|lâ}} is not {{Tone|5}} + {{t|lả}}. Rather, each of {{Tone|5}} and {{t|lả}} is a complementizer in its own right. So really {{t|lâ}} is also its own complementizer, of which {{Tone|5}} is an allomorph.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
== History ==&lt;br /&gt;
There used to be a &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;flat tone&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; {{tone|1}}, which marked the continuation of a multisyllable word. But now, the tone contour is spread out over the whole word. This was tone #1, but now it is gone. So we start counting from #2, because it would be more confusing to re-number them.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The rising-creaky tone {{tone|3}} used to be dipping {{tone|3old}}, and {{tone|7}} was just “creaky”.&lt;br /&gt;
